What are NAICS codes?

NAICS codes, or the North American Industry Classification System codes, are essential identifiers for businesses in North America. They categorize businesses according to their industry sector and subsector, allowing for a standardized method of tracking economic activities across the U.S., Canada, and Mexico. This system replaced the older Standard Industrial Classification (SIC) system in 1997.

The purpose of NAICS codes is to provide a clear and consistent framework for businesses, researchers, and government bodies to classify economic data. This uniformity aids in economic analysis, policymaking, and various reporting requirements, thus forming an integral component of economic statistics.

Understanding NAICS codes

The development of NAICS codes arose from a need for a modernized approach to industry classification as the economy evolved. The codes consist of six digits, where each digit provides increasingly nuanced information about the business's specific activity. For example, the first two digits identify the broad economic sector, while successively more specific digits narrow down the classification.

NAICS codes are not just an arbitrary numbering system; they have tangible implications for businesses. Accurate classification ensures proper regulatory compliance, eligibility for certain government programs, and appropriate measures for economic models, making it crucial for businesses to report their NAICS codes correctly.

Tips for accurate NAICS codes reporting

When reporting NAICS codes, understanding the correct classification is key. Choosing the right NAICS code requires diligence and sometimes assistance from industry experts.

Research your industry thoroughly to identify the most appropriate NAICS code. Industry associations and databases can be great resources.
Consult with a business advisor for insight on nuanced industry challenges that may affect classification.
Regularly review your NAICS codes to adapt to any changes in business structure or activities.

Common mistakes to avoid include misclassifying your business under a category that does not reflect primary operations, which can lead to compliance issues or incorrect data reporting in federal statistics. Regular updates are also essential, as outdated information may hinder your business's access to key resources.
